Output 668978dd09e798e665e9f3bab18c043842ba83e51cf5a2221255055ee26ad171:19

value
2720237
script pubkey
OP_0 OP_PUSHBYTES_32 e4107950ca455a828b1fdd389539186e324973c1654677a3945964a20413ca81
address
bc1qusg8j5x2g4dg9zclm5uf2wgcdceyju7pv4r80gu5t9j2ypqne2qsmqersz
transaction
668978dd09e798e665e9f3bab18c043842ba83e51cf5a2221255055ee26ad171
spent
true